what does spatial mean? i'm taking ap human geo, and it pops up everywhere. some examples:
-geospatial data
-spatial patterns
-spatial models
please help! giving away 10 points.
The definition of spatial is: relating to or using space.
Geospatial data is time-based data that is related to a specific location on the Earth's surface. It can provide insights into relationships between variables and reveal patterns and trends.
A spatial pattern is an intuitive structure, placement, or arrangement of objects on Earth. It also includes the space in between those objects. Patterns may be recognized because of their arrangement; maybe in a line or by a grouping of points.
Spatial modeling is an analytical process managed with a geographical information system (GIS) in order to describe basic processes and properties for a given set of spatial features.

Find the DISTANCES of AB and CD to determine if AB is congruent to CD. A(-7,1) B(-4,-3) C(3,-5) D(7,-2)
Answer:
AB is congruent to CD
Explanation:
Given the following :
A(-7,1) B(-4,-3) C(3,-5) D(7,-2)
Distance AB:
A(-7,1) ; B(-4,-3) ;
AB = √[(X2 - x1)^2 + (y2 - y1)^2]
AB = √[(-4 - (-7))^2 + (-3 - 1)^2]
AB = √[(-4 + 7)^2 + (-3 - 1)^2]
AB = √[(3)^2 + (-4)^2]
AB = √(9 + 16)
AB = √25
AB = 5
C(3,-5) D(7,-2)
Distance CD ; x1 = 3, y1 = - 5, x2 = 7, y2 = - 2
CD = √[(X2 - x1)^2 + (y2 - y1)^2]
CD = √[(7 - 3)^2 + (-2 - (-5))^2]
CD = √[( 4 )^2 + (-2 + 5)^2]
CD = √[(4)^2 + (3)^2]
CD = √(16 + 9)
CD = √25
CD = 5
CD = AB, Hence, AB is Congruent to CD

Explain the features on the planet Earth that allows living things to live on the planet.
Answer:
Distance of the Earth from the Sun- The Earth and the Sun are equally important because without the Sun's heat and light, the Earth would be a lifeless ball of ice-coated rocks. It regulates the temperature of water bodies, weather patterns and provides energy to the growth of plants. The distance of the Earth from the Sun makes it a perfect reason for the life because it receives the perfect amount of heat and light to allow life to be created and to support it. Light on the Earth- Earth is the only planet that uses the Sun’s light as useful as a source of energy. That energy is used to convert elements, by living things, into a useable form. A plant uses the energy provided by the sun to drive photosynthesis and provide food to grow. As a by-product, oxygen is released which we then use as an energy source of our own. The Earth's Atmosphere- It is the layers of gases surrounding the earth that consists of exosphere, thermosphere, mesosphere, stratosphere and troposphere. The air content and favourable atmospheric pressure also supported life of most creatures. The less air content of carbon dioxide helps to moderate the Earth's temperature and is absorbed by plants during photosynthesis to produce oxygen.The Ozone Layer- It is the Ozone layer that is a part of Earth's atmosphere situated in the stratosphere, which makes protects life on Earth from its potentially harmful effects of shorter wavelength and highly hazardous ultraviolet radiation (UVR) from the sun. The Sun emits enormous amounts of heat and light that also consists of ultraviolet radiation (UV rays). Only about 1% of the ultraviolet radiation that the Sun sends to Earth actually reaches the surface. Small amounts of exposure to UV rays are beneficial because they cause the body to produce Vitamin D, which has several health benefits.
